although the idea may seems little silly, I think it has some merit to it when it comes down to auditory feedback.
I have stock 328i which I love the fact that the exhaust is not so noisy. I feel like most of the exhaust mods available for 328 are mostly for sound. I would definitely purchase a tuned exhaust, but since this won't be my permanent car, I can't justify spending money into it. However, whenever I do little spirited driving, I wish it was loud enough to "gauge" the rpm by sound. This is especially useful when rev matching on downshifts, timing my shift according to engine sound instead of guessing or looking at tachometer. When I had my other cars with exhausts, rev matching came as thing of nature by auditory feedback. I guess I'm too much of purist to use this gadget, but could be useful tool for someone who wants little more feedback from engine besides tach. |
